School Holiday Programme: ANZAC Poppies
Te Manawa Museum 326 Main St, Palmerston North, Manawatū, New ZealandCreate a beautiful paper poppy to remember those who have served. Add one to our wreath and make another to take home.

Te Manawa is closed on Mondays during term time, but open during school holidays.
NOA is a program designed to create a welcoming environment for those who would otherwise not consider the museum to be a place for them.
NOA is open to anyone and generally attended by differently abled folks.
The programme runs every Wednesday morning from 10am - 12pm. NOA runs during school term times and does not run during school holidays.
